If you gave the first number, they said okay and their pay band goes significantly higher, that's regular negotiation. They don't have to say yes if you don't have a competitive offer, but it would be stupid for them to lose a strong candidate
If they told you the range, you said yes, and later discovered that the top of the range for that role is significantly below your market value, you're screwed.
my take, depends do u have “b*lls of steel” (or equivalent) or not. are you willing to walk away from the offer?
if the answer is yes to both, be honest and just say hey really interested in this role, super impressed by my interviewers and really see myself growing here, so asked a bit more and met a few people and saw the salary range significantly diff than my initial thoughts. my expectation is to be within range of colleagues of X-Y.
